Files
bullet3/Demos/VectorAdd_OpenCL/Apple/CMakeLists.txt
erwin.coumans 7bfa94b6a3 implement barrier/critical section for OSX (PosixThreadSupport)
enable Demos/ThreadingDemo for OSX
add cmake build support for VectorAdd_OpenCL for OSX
2010-06-28 23:03:14 +00:00

26 lines
485 B
CMake

# AppVectorAdd is a very basic test OpenCL/MiniCL.
IF (APPLE)
FIND_LIBRARY(OPENCL_LIBRARY OpenCL DOC "OpenCL lib for OSX")
FIND_PATH(OPENCL_INCLUDE_DIR OpenCL/cl.h DOC "Include for OpenCL on OSX")
ENDIF (APPLE)
INCLUDE_DIRECTORIES(
${BULLET_PHYSICS_SOURCE_DIR}/src
)
LINK_LIBRARIES(
LinearMath ${OPENCL_LIBRARY}
)
ADD_EXECUTABLE(AppVectorAdd_Apple
../MiniCL_VectorAdd.cpp
../VectorAddKernels.cl
)
IF (UNIX)
TARGET_LINK_LIBRARIES(AppVectorAdd_Apple pthread)
ENDIF(UNIX)